CVE-2017-1670
CRITICAL · CVSS 9.8
EPSS exploitation probability: 0%
Published 2018-01-09T20:29:00.397 · Last modified 2026-06-17T01:14:40.253

Summary

IBM Tivoli Key Lifecycle Manager 2.5, 2.6, and 2.7 is vulnerable to SQL injection. A remote attacker could send specially-crafted SQL statements, which could allow the attacker to view, add, modify or delete information in the back-end database. IBM X-Force ID: 133637.

Affected products

ibm — security_key_lifecycle_manager
